Modern Warfare 3 has received its first major patch since the game's release on November 10. Patch 1.33 came out Wednesday on all platforms, and it's one that's been highly anticipated. The problem, unfortunately, is that so much of what players were looking forward to didn't actually make it.
Developer Sledgehammer Games said in a note released alongside the patch notes that some of the scheduled changes will instead be released with the next update. The list of missing fixes includes Zombies, general weapon balance, stability and more.
With that said, patch 1.33 is a hefty one in its own right, bringing multiple fixes to the game across all of its modes, even the dreaded COD HQ. The patch also adds DLSS 3.0 support to the PC version, for those using GeForce RTX 40 series GPUs.
